Firehouse Subs Deerwood

Closed
8221-4 Southside Blvd.
32256 Jacksonville
Florida, FL
Show path to location
(904) 996-0894
30.2201096, -81.5516329
Opening hours
Location overview
Have you noticed any mistakes?

Similar locations